This book provides a glimpse into the 19th-century criminal underworld through the eyes of Eugene Francois Vidocq, a thief and con artist who later became a police agent. The book is a fascinating exploration of the criminal mind, with Vidocq offering a unique insight into the motivations and methods of criminals, as well as the inner workings of the police force. Vidocq's story is set against the backdrop of a rapidly changing society and the rise of professional policing. His tale provides a unique perspective on the era's social conditions. Moreover, it reflects on the complex and often contradictory nature of human behavior, exploring the depths of criminality and redemption. Overall, this book is a valuable historical document and a gripping read, offering a remarkable account of crime and policing in the 19th century, while delving into profound questions about justice, morality, and the nature of the self.
